How to apply
Open official application page
  1. 1Create your single profile on the HPRCA portal. The Aayog's FAQ states that a user can create only one profile, and that the profile can be updated at any time.
  2. 2Complete the profile fully before you apply. The Aayog's FAQ states that the profile should be 100% complete before applying for a post.
  3. 3Open the Advertisements page, find the advertisement carrying the post code you want, and read it with every addendum, corrigendum and public notice issued against it.
  4. 4Apply online against that post code within the window printed in the advertisement, watching for any public notice extending the last date — the Aayog issues those separately.
  5. 5Check everything before you submit. The Aayog's FAQ states that once the application is submitted candidates cannot make changes, and asks candidates to review their details before submitting. If the Aayog later opens a correction window it publishes a notice naming the advertisement.
  6. 6Download the admit card when the Aayog publishes the admit-card link for your post code, and reach the examination centre at least half an hour before the examination starts — the Aayog states that latecomers will not be permitted to enter the examination hall.
  7. 7After the paper, use the objection window against the provisional answer key, and then the cross-objection window, within the dates the Aayog publishes for your post code.
FAQs
Is there one 'HPRCA exam' I can prepare for?

No. HPRCA is a recruiting commission, not an examination. It advertises Group-C posts one at a time, each with its own advertisement number and post code, its own eligibility taken from that post's rules, its own computer-based test and its own dates. Find your post code and read that advertisement.

What is HPRCA and when was it set up?

The Himachal Pradesh Rajya Chayan Aayog. Its own About page states that it operates under the administrative control of the Department of Personnel, Government of Himachal Pradesh, that it was established on 30th September 2023, and that it was constituted in exercise of the powers conferred by Article 192 read with the proviso to Article 309 of the Constitution of India. Its head office is at Hamirpur, Himachal Pradesh, Pin 177001.

What was it called before?

This catalogue row is filed under the conducting body 'HP Rajya Chayan Aayog (formerly HPSSC)' — the Himachal Pradesh Staff Selection Commission, which also sat at Hamirpur. The Aayog's own About page does not mention its predecessor, and no official notification recording the dissolution of the former Commission could be retrieved for this record, so nothing further about the change is asserted here. Everything current is published under the name Himachal Pradesh Rajya Chayan Aayog.

Which posts does HPRCA recruit for?

All Group-C services and posts under the Government of Himachal Pradesh, with exclusions, plus Group-C posts in state PSUs, boards, corporations, government universities and local bodies that entrust their recruitment to it. In practice its notice board runs from subject teachers and Junior Basic Training Teachers through Junior Engineer (Civil), Assistant Staff Nurse, Medical Laboratory Technician, Junior Office Assistant (Library) and Steno Typist to printing-press cadres such as Proof Reader, Copy Holder and Offset Operator.

Which posts does HPRCA NOT recruit for?

Its own About page lists the exclusions: posts in the High Court of Himachal Pradesh, the Himachal Pradesh Vidhan Sabha and the Himachal Pradesh Public Service Commission; Group-C posts for wards of government employees who die in harness; Group-C posts reserved for ex-servicemen, including one dependent of defence personnel killed or disabled in action; Group-C posts reserved for physically handicapped candidates; other posts excluded by the State Government; 50% of Class-III posts filled through batch-wise recruitment; Surveyor posts in the Public Works Department; and Junior Basic Trained Teachers in the Education Department where recruitment is on merit and batch-wise.

Where do I find the eligibility and syllabus?

Only in the advertisement for your post code, on the Advertisements page of hprca.hp.gov.in, read with every addendum, corrigendum and public notice issued against that advertisement. There is no common HPRCA eligibility rule and no common HPRCA syllabus, and anything sold as one is not from the Aayog.

How are the examinations conducted?

As computer-based tests, post code by post code, on separate dates. The Aayog instructs that candidates appearing for its CBT examinations must be at the examination centre at least half an hour before the examination begins, and that latecomers will not be permitted to enter the examination hall.

Can I correct my application after submitting it?

Not on your own. The Aayog's FAQ states that once the application is submitted candidates cannot make changes, and asks candidates to review their details before submitting. The Aayog does sometimes reopen applications, but only by publishing a 'notice regarding correction window' against a named advertisement number — its list carries such notices against several 2026 and 2025 advertisements.

How many profiles can I create on the portal?

One. The Aayog's FAQ states that a user can create only one profile, that the profile can be updated at any time, and that the profile should be 100% complete before applying for a post.

What happens after the examination?

The Aayog publishes a provisional answer key and opens an objection window for the named post codes, then a cross-objection window, and then publishes the final answer key. Results and recommendation lists follow. All of this appears on its own portal as dated links addressed to a post code.

Someone is asking me to pay for an HPRCA mock test. Is that official?

The Aayog's own home page warns: do not make any payments for the mock test through unknown, unofficial, or fraudulent links. If a payment demand does not come from hprca.hp.gov.in, do not pay it.

I want a Group-A or Group-B post in Himachal Pradesh. Is that HPRCA?

No. HPRCA's remit is Group-C, and posts in the Himachal Pradesh Public Service Commission are expressly excluded from its purview. The Public Service Commission is a separate body with its own site, linked from the Aayog's own portal; the catalogue row for it is hppsc.
